express Definition
(n)
rapid
transport
of
goods
(n)
mail
that
is
distributed
by
a
rapid
and
efficient
system
(n)
public
transport
consisting
of
a
fast
train
or
bus
that
makes
a
limited
number
of
scheduled
stops
; "
he
caught
the
express
to
New
York
"
(r)
by
express
; "
please
send
the
letter
express
"
(s)
not
tacit
or
implied
; "
her
express
wish
"
(s)
without
unnecessary
stops
; "
an
express
train
"; "
an
express
shipment
"
(v)
give
expression
to
; "
She
showed
her
disappointment
"
(v)
articulate
;
either
verbally
or
with
a
cry
,
shout
,
or
noise
; "
She
expressed
her
anger
"; "
He
uttered
a
curse
"
(v)
indicate
through
a
symbol
,
formula
,
etc
.; "
Can
you
express
this
distance
in
kilometers
?"
(v)
serve
as
a
means
for
expressing
something
; "
The
painting
of
Mary
carries
motherly
love
"; "
His
voice
carried
a
lot
af
anger
"
(v)
manifest
the
effects
of
(
a
gene
or
genetic
trait
); "
Many
of
the
laboratory
animals
express
the
trait
"
(v)
obtain
from
a
substance
,
as
by
mechanical
action
; "
Italians
express
coffee
rather
than
filter
it
"
(v)
send
my
rapid
transport
or
special
messenger
service
; "
She
expressed
the
letter
to
Florida
"
